A national fire and security solutions provider in Glasgow seeks a Junior Fire Engineer. The role involves maintaining fire and security systems, delivering exceptional customer service, and undergoing training through the Marlowe Academy.
Applicants must have a UK Drivers License and demonstrate key attributes like attention to detail and professionalism.
The compensation includes an OTE of £40,000 and various benefits such as a company van, training opportunities, and a generous pension scheme.
